          I found a US retailer that has the 0901 in stock size 36,  I wear a size 34 in the 1955s cut…...  since these are raw will a 36 be ok?  I was thinking hot soak and warm dry.......

          They probably will work, they should be a bit thinner through the seat and thighs than the IH 55 cut.  They are a classic loose straight fit, but not quite as generous as the 55.  Closer to the 634, I'd say.  Since you're going up a size or so, that gives you the option to really try shrinking them down.  Momotaros are really dark and don't seem to lose much indigo in a wash, so you can run them through the machine a couple of times without worrying about lots of fading.  They also don't seem to stretch much, so whatever shrinkage you get, you'll probably keep.

                                      I am wearing these as I type this.  They are (well, were) BRUTALLY slim in the top block from your crotch up.  The thigh isn't that bad and they aren't really slim at all from the knee down, but it took me almost a week to stretch out the top block to the point that it wasn't painful.  What is tricky about them is that the measurements online are somewhat deceitful.  By the numbers they don't look that tight…but then put them on.  I purchased a 32 (I normally wear a 32 in just about everything) and for the first day I couldn't button the top 3 buttons.  Once they stretch out on top though they fit like butter.  You may want to size up 1 to play it safe.
